Output 18c5618431baef0206ab8042c545bf384ec13e7f9489aa6fa79767697ba6c58c:79

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d6a31775c6155b8663a9a4e8aeb21a8e4fc507bc13fbcf1d4c77b1ebda826f2a
address
bc1p6633wawxz4dcvcaf5n52avs63e8u2pauz0au782vw7c7hk5zdu4qmaz37x
transaction
18c5618431baef0206ab8042c545bf384ec13e7f9489aa6fa79767697ba6c58c
spent
true